Cuban Chimichurri Recipe
  • Prep/Total Time: 20 min.
  • Yield: 8 Servings

Ingredients

  • 7 garlic cloves, peeled
  • 1-1/4 cups packed fresh cilantro leaves
  • 3/4 cup packed fresh parsley sprigs
  • 1 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es
  • 1 teaspoon coarsely ground pepper
  • 1/4 cup white balsamic vinegar
  • 2 tablespoons lime juice
  • 1 tablespoon soy sauce
  • 1/2 teaspoon grated lime peel
  • 1/3 cup olive oil
  • Grilled steak

Directions

  • Place garlic in a small food processor; cover and chop. Add the cilantro, parsley, pepper flakes and pepper; cover and process until finely chopped.
  • Add the vinegar, lime juice, soy sauce and lime peel. While processing, gradually add oil in a steady stream. Serve with steak. Yield: 1 cup.

Nutritional Facts 2 tablespoons equals 95 calories, 9 g fat (1 g saturated fat), 0 cholesterol, 122 mg sodium, 3 g carbohydrate, trace fiber, 1 g protein.
